How Manufacturers Are Reducing Waste in Garden Statue Production
Wholesale garden statue producers are implementing cutting-edge techniques to minimize waste throughout the production process. Advanced mold-making technologies allow for more precise casting, reducing excess material usage. Computer-aided design (CAD) software enables manufacturers to optimize the use of raw materials, resulting in less scrap. Additionally, many garden statue manufacturers are adopting closed-loop production systems, where water and other resources are recycled within the facility. The Rise of Recycled and Upcycled Materials in Modern Garden Statuary
The concept of upcycling has found its way into the garden statue industry, breathing new life into discarded materials. Innovative garden statue manufacturers are sourcing recycled metals, reclaimed wood, and even repurposed industrial waste to create unique and environmentally friendly sculptures. This approach not only reduces the demand for virgin materials but also results in one-of-a-kind pieces that tell a story.
